Dispatch: November 17, 2023

Dispatch: A summary of recent business appointments and announcements, plus upcoming events for the week ahead

APPOINTED Kate Graham, Duncanson Family Faculty Fellow, leading the Public Policy and Governance program, Huron University.

PROMOTED Deborah Gibbs, to associate director of development, Ronald McDonald House Charities Southwestern Ontario.

SOLD Image Graphics and Signs (8-9 60 Meg Drive), to Muhammad Zeeshan and Malik Yasir Awan (former owner Muslim Hooda to remain as manager).

APPOINTED Dr. Robyn Klein, Canada Excellence Research Chair in Neurovirology and Neuroimmunology, Western University.  

APPOINTED Cristina Stanciu, inaugural Fulbright Canada Research Chair in Justice and Reconciliation (2024 winter term), King’s University College.

NAMED Erin Craven (founder, Urospot), a 2023 Canada’s Most Powerful Women: Top 100 (Compass Rose Entrepreneurs category), by the Women’s Executive Network.

ANNOUNCED By Labatt Breweries of Canada, $26.6-million expansion of its London brewery.

APPOINTED Kamran Siddiqui (associate dean, graduate and postdoctoral studies, Faculty of Engineering, vice-provost graduate and postdoctoral studies, Western University (for a five-year term effective January 1, 2024).

LAUNCHED 519 Growth Fund II (519 GFII), a $30-million venture capital fund from RHA Ventures Inc.

AWARDED Giant Creative, Canadian Marketing Awards 2023 Gold Award (Health Care category) for it Faces of Heroes campaign (client: London Health Sciences Foundation).

ANNOUNCED By TechAlliance of Southwestern Ontario, finalists for the 2023 London Innovation Challenge: Broad Films, Corduroy Earth, DIBZ and Joydrop.

PROMOTED Laura Gonzalez-Lara, to research associate, Western University.

OPENED London regional office of My Insurance Guy, 470 Colborne Street.

ANNOUNCED By Odd Burger Corporation, credit facility agreement with Vegan World LLC in the amount of CAD $250,000.

OPENED The Chef’s Table Market at Fanshawe College, 130 Dundas Street.

PROMOTED Nando D’Oria, to commercial insurance vice president, Gallagher.

APPOINTED Heather Hoare, director of community engagement, Youth Opportunities Unlimited.

ANNOUNCED By the Government of Canada, $157 million in low-interest financing through the Rental Construction Financing Initiative to fund 588 purpose-built rental units at 391 South Street and 60 purpose-built rental units at 300 Manor Road (St. Thomas).
